#288370 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#288370 is composed of 15.7% red, 51.4%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 167.5 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 33.5%. #288370 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ffe0 with #000700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#288370 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#288370 has RGB values of R:40, G:131,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2655088.

Shades and Tints of #288370
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b09 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#288370
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5c59 is the less saturated color, while #01aa87 is the most saturated one.
